Medium Ruby. Aromas of fresh red cherry, wild flowers, dried herbs & roses. Flavors of fresh & dried cherry with some black licorice.
Particularly earthy & with distinctive volcanic created minerality.
Both light & bold, a seeming contradiction that makes them so interesting & unique.
Named after & planted on the Etna volcano on the Eastern side of Sicily.
Eta Rosso wines are a blend of native grapes Nerello Mascalese & Nerello Cappuccio (aka Nerello Mantellato), 20% max.
A simlar blend is used in Faro Rosso wines with Nerello Mascalese 45-60% of the blend, Nerello Cappuccio accounting for 15-30%, Nocera 5-10% Nocera, while Galioppo, Nero d'Avola and/or Sangiovese up to 15% max. and tend to be lower in alcohol.
Very versatile with food. Poultry, pork, salmon & tuna pair well, & a wide variety of pastas. Tomato sauces are a natural pairing.
